Offered to the market with no onward chain, this exceptional modern two-bedroom park home is beautifully presented throughout and enjoys a peaceful setting within the stunning Blackdown Hills countryside, just a five-minute drive from Chard town centre and its wide range of amenities. Designed for comfortable and low-maintenance living, the accommodation comprises a bright open-plan sitting room, dining area and modern fitted kitchen, creating a sociable and welcoming living space. The property also benefits from a contemporary shower room, a single bedroom currently utilised as a dressing room, and a generous master bedroom with en-suite WC. Outside, the home occupies a spacious and well-maintained plot with attractive low-maintenance gardens incorporating artificial lawn, gravelled areas and flower beds. A veranda accessed directly from the dining area provides the perfect space for alfresco dining and relaxing, while a second smaller veranda leads to the main entrance. Further benefits include a utility shed with power and lighting, a separate tool shed, and off-road parking for several vehicles. The property is warmed by gas central heating via a combination boiler supplied by lpg bottled gas. Reserved for the over 50s, this is a rare opportunity to acquire a truly immaculate park home in a tranquil countryside setting. Council Tax Band A. Pitch fee £238.73 per calendar month including sewerage
